About

Fitness Park RVL 13 is a free outdoor fitness area in Prague designed for the kind of unstructured physical activity that kids and teens thrive on. Unlike a traditional playground, this is a proper fitness park — pull-up bars, parallel bars, balance beams, and open workout equipment that challenges the body in ways that screens and sitting simply can't.

For families with older kids and teens who've outgrown playground swings, RVL 13 hits a sweet spot. The equipment is robust enough for real exercise but approachable enough that kids without any fitness background can jump in and start exploring. Younger school-age children can also get a lot out of climbing, hanging, and testing their strength on the various structures.

The outdoor setting means it's weather-dependent, so plan accordingly. Prague's spring and summer are ideal for RVL 13 — long days, mild temperatures, and the kind of light that makes an outdoor workout feel like anything but a workout.

There are no facilities on-site (no toilets, no café), so bring water and any snacks you need. The park is free and unattended, so families can drop in anytime without booking or paying. It's the kind of spontaneous stop that turns an ordinary afternoon walk into a genuine activity.
